  • Title

    Evaluation of Rayleigh scattering loss in photonic crystal fibers by using bi-directional OTDR measurement

  • Abstract
    We investigate the scattering loss in photonic crystal fibers with different structures by using bi-directional OTDR measurement. Their intrinsic Rayleigh scattering coefficient is slightly less than that of conventional pure silica core single-mode fiber.
